A St. Louis County teenager was hurt in a single-car accident Saturday morning (March 14) on Hwy. W near the Fox Run Golf Course in the Hoene Springs area.

The Missouri State Highway Patrol reported that Jack Hosick, 19, of Wildwood was driving a 1999 Toyota Camry west on Hwy. W near Patty Drive at 10:50 a.m. when the car slid off the roadway and the front of the car struck the ground.

Hosick suffered moderate injuries and was taken by the Eureka Fire Protection District to Mercy Hospital South in south St. Louis County, the report said.

An update on his condition was not available.

He was wearing a seat belt, the report said. The Camry had extensive damage.
